Q: Is 17,801,011 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 17,801,011 is not a prime number.

Why is 17,801,011 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 17801011 can be evenly divided by 1 23 41 43 439 943 989 1,763 10,097 17,999 18,877 40,549 413,977 434,171 773,957 and 17,801,011, with no remainder.

Since 17,801,011 cannot be divided by just 1 and 17,801,011, it is not a prime number.
